Common Issues and Errors Related to jabsysinfo.dll
DLL files often play a critical role in system operations. Despite their importance, these files can sometimes source system errors. Below we consider some of the most frequently encountered faults associated with DLL files.
- The file jabsysinfo.dll is missing: The specified DLL file couldn't be found. It may have been unintentionally deleted or moved from its original location.
- Jabsysinfo.dll not found: This indicates that the application you're trying to run is looking for a specific DLL file that it can't locate. This could be due to the DLL file being missing, corrupted, or incorrectly installed.
- Jabsysinfo.dll Access Violation: The error signifies that an operation attempted to access a protected portion of memory associated with the jabsysinfo.dll. This could happen due to improper coding, software incompatibilities, or memory-related issues.
- Jabsysinfo.dll could not be loaded: This means that the DLL file required by a specific program or process could not be loaded into memory. This could be due to corruption of the DLL file, improper installation, or compatibility issues with your operating system.

Perform a Repair Install of Windows
How to perform a repair install of Windows to repair jabsysinfo.dll issues.
-
Go to the Microsoft website and download the Windows 10 Media Creation Tool.
-
Run the tool and select Create installation media for another PC.
-
Follow the prompts to create a bootable USB drive or ISO file.
-
Insert the Windows 10 installation media you created into your PC and run setup.exe.
-
Follow the prompts until you get to the Ready to install screen.
-
On the Ready to install screen, make sure Keep personal files and apps is selected.
-
Click Install to start the repair install.
-
Your computer will restart several times during the installation. Make sure not to turn off your computer during this process.
